Israel has decided to open three ‘Centres of Excellence’ in the field of agriculture in Karnataka. The country also plans to open its second consulate in India, in Bangalore by October to attract tourists, especially from South India. Speaking to Deccan Herald, the Consul General for Israel in India, Orna Sagiv said the country was now targeting three major sectors in Karnataka – IT, agriculture and food processing.
